在数字货币全球化进程加速的当下,USDT支付系统与OTC承兑商系统已成为连接法币与加密资产的核心基础设施。本文基于2024-2025年行业最新实践,深度解析两大系统的技术架构、合规策略与生态协同机制。
一、USDT支付系统开发核心技术架构
1. 区块链网络选型策略
根据实际业务需求选择适配的USDT协议标准:
• 高频交易场景:优先采用TRC20协议,实测交易确认速度可达3秒/笔,单笔手续费低于0.1美元
• 跨境支付场景:选择ERC20协议,利用以太坊生态的全球节点覆盖优势,支持170+国家/地区的合规对接
• 大额转账场景:配置Omni Layer协议作为备份通道,通过比特币网络的算力保障实现超10亿美元级交易安全
2. 智能合约开发规范
采用模块化设计理念构建支付合约体系:
solidity
// ERC20 USDT支付合约示例(来源网页[5][9])
contract USDT_Payment {
mapping(address => uint256) private _balances;
function transferWithKYC(address recipient, uint256 amount) external {
require(KYCRegistry.check(msg.sender), "KYC verification failed");
_transfer(msg.sender, recipient, amount);
emit PaymentProcessed(msg.sender, recipient, amount, block.timestamp);
}
function batchTransfer(address[] memory recipients, uint256[] memory amounts) external {
require(recipients.length == amounts.length, "Array length mismatch");
for (uint i=0; i<recipients.length; i++) {
_transfer(msg.sender, recipients[i], amounts[i]);
}
}
}
• 安全验证模块:集成零知识证明技术实现隐私交易,交易金额可见但账户信息加密
• 批量处理模块:单次交易支持200+地址同时转账,Gas消耗降低92%
• 熔断机制:当单日交易量突增300%时自动触发人工审核流程
二、OTC承兑商系统核心功能设计
1. 系统运转机制
构建"四层防护"的承兑生态体系:
-
准入层:承兑商需质押10万USDT+通过AML/KYC认证
-
交易层:采用智能匹配算法,根据承兑商流动性自动分配订单(见图2)
-
清算层:通过多重签名钱包实现T+0即时结算
-
监控层:接入Chainalysis等链上分析工具,实时扫描可疑交易
2. 关键技术实现
• 流动性管理算法:
python
# 承兑商流动性动态分配模型(来源网页[6][7])
def liquidity_allocation(order_amount, merchant_liquidity):
allocation = []
total_weight = sum([m['score'] for m in merchant_liquidity])
for m in merchant_liquidity:
weight = m['score'] / total_weight
allocate = min(order_amount * weight, m['available'])
allocation.append({'merchant': m['id'], 'amount': allocate})
order_amount -= allocate
if order_amount <= 0: break
return allocation
• 风险定价模型:根据承兑商历史成交率、投诉率动态调整手续费率(0.1%-0.8%浮动区间)
• 灾备机制:设置分布式订单池,单个节点故障时10秒内完成交易迁移
三、合规风控体系建设
1. 全球牌照矩阵
| 牌照类型 | 覆盖区域 | 申请周期 | 成本范围 |
|----------------|----------------|-----------|---------------|
| 美国MSB牌照 | 北美市场 | 3-5个月 | $15,000-$25,000 |
| 立陶宛EMI牌照 | 欧盟经济体 | 2-4个月 | €8,000-€15,000 |
| 新加坡PSA牌照 | 东南亚市场 | 6-8个月 | SGD 50,000+ |
2. 反洗钱技术栈
• 身份核验:集成Jumio、Onfido等生物识别方案,实名认证通过率提升至99.3%
• 交易监控:设置300+风控规则,包括:
• 同一设备24小时内交易超$50,000自动冻结
• 新注册用户首笔交易限额$1,000
• 审计追踪:采用星形日志存储结构,满足6年数据回溯要求
四、生态协同创新实践
1. 支付+OTC联动模型
构建"双循环"商业生态:
• 用户侧:通过支付系统沉淀的消费数据,智能推荐最优OTC兑换渠道(节省汇率损失0.5%-1.2%)
• 商户侧:建立流动性共享池,支持支付系统与OTC系统的实时资金调拨(响应时间<500ms)
2. RWA创新场景
• 票据贴现:企业可将应收账款凭证上链,通过USDT支付系统实现分钟级贴现
• 跨境贸易:结合信用证智能合约,实现"发货即付款"的自动化结算(某试点项目节省结算周期40天)
五、开发者实施指南
1. 环境配置
• 安装Hardhat框架并配置多链开发环境(支持以太坊/Tron/BSC)
• 部署The Graph节点实现链上数据索引
2. 压力测试标准
• 支付系统:模拟10万并发交易,TPS不低于2000
• OTC系统:订单匹配延迟需控制在200ms以内
3. 合规检查清单
• 完成SOC2 Type II审计报告
• 接入至少3家合规法币通道
> "2025年USDT支付生态将呈现基础设施模块化、合规方案区域化、应用场景碎片化三大趋势"
通过深度整合支付系统与OTC系统的技术能力,开发者可构建具备自我进化能力的加密金融生态。据最新数据显示,采用协同架构的项目用户留存率提升58%,日均交易规模增长超400%,标志着行业已进入生态化竞争新阶段。